Output 8590c625b88becc26762af5baff04283ba69ef9b2750510bacafc8c894aa7292:2

value
5536397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 010e986c90f0f0040dd16f1f567b9d791032271b OP_EQUALVERIFY OP_CHECKSIG
address
16bAJK1sH98w8S8CoK37WWwUhJTm5dsw7
transaction
8590c625b88becc26762af5baff04283ba69ef9b2750510bacafc8c894aa7292
spent
true